The User and Entity Behavior Analytics (UEBA) software market is experiencing robust growth, projected to reach $387.9 million in 2025 and maintain a Compound Annual Growth Rate (CAGR) of 8.8% from 2025 to 2033. This expansion is fueled by several key drivers. The increasing sophistication of cyber threats necessitates advanced security solutions capable of detecting insider threats and advanced persistent threats (APTs) that traditional security information and event management (SIEM) systems often miss. The rise of cloud computing and the increasing adoption of hybrid work models have also contributed significantly, as UEBA solutions provide crucial visibility across diverse IT environments. Furthermore, stringent data privacy regulations, like GDPR and CCPA, are driving demand for solutions that can effectively monitor user activity and ensure compliance. Market segmentation reveals a strong preference for cloud-based solutions among both large enterprises and SMEs, reflecting the inherent scalability and cost-effectiveness of this deployment model. Competition is fierce, with established players like IBM and Microsoft vying for market share alongside innovative specialized vendors such as Haystax and Securonix. Geographic distribution indicates strong growth across North America and Europe, driven by high technological adoption and a mature security landscape. However, emerging markets in Asia-Pacific are also poised for significant expansion as businesses increasingly prioritize cybersecurity.
Continued growth in the UEBA market is expected to be driven by the ongoing evolution of cyber threats and the increasing complexity of IT infrastructures. The need for real-time threat detection and proactive security measures will further fuel demand for sophisticated UEBA solutions. While on-premises deployments still hold a segment of the market, the trend strongly favors cloud-based solutions due to their scalability, ease of management, and reduced infrastructure costs. The competitive landscape will likely see further consolidation as companies seek to expand their capabilities through acquisitions and strategic partnerships. Furthermore, advancements in Artificial Intelligence (AI) and Machine Learning (ML) will likely enhance the capabilities of UEBA solutions, providing even more accurate threat detection and improved response times. Regional variations in growth will continue, with established markets showing consistent growth while emerging economies witness rapid expansion driven by rising digitalization and increased cybersecurity awareness.

Several key factors are fueling the growth of the UEBA software market. The increasing prevalence and sophistication of cyberattacks, including insider threats and advanced persistent threats (APTs), are a primary driver. Organizations are recognizing the limitations of traditional security solutions in detecting these threats and are turning to UEBA's advanced analytics capabilities to identify anomalous behavior patterns indicative of malicious activity. The rise of remote work and the expansion of the attack surface have further increased the urgency for robust security measures, making UEBA a critical component of a comprehensive security strategy. Compliance regulations like GDPR and CCPA are also placing greater emphasis on data security and privacy, compelling organizations to implement advanced security solutions like UEBA to demonstrate compliance. Furthermore, the growing adoption of cloud-based services and applications presents new security challenges, as data resides in multiple locations and environments. UEBA solutions provide visibility into these distributed environments, enabling organizations to detect and respond to threats effectively, regardless of their location. The increased availability of readily accessible UEBA solutions, particularly via cloud-based platforms and MSSPs, is further democratizing access to this critical technology. Finally, the continuous development of AI and machine learning capabilities is enhancing the effectiveness and efficiency of UEBA solutions, leading to better threat detection and response.
Despite the significant growth potential, the UEBA software market faces several challenges. One major hurdle is the complexity of implementing and managing UEBA systems. These solutions require specialized expertise to configure, integrate, and maintain effectively. The high cost of implementation and maintenance can also be a barrier to entry, particularly for smaller organizations with limited budgets. Furthermore, the need for skilled professionals capable of interpreting UEBA alerts and responding to security incidents presents a significant challenge. A shortage of cybersecurity professionals with the necessary skills and experience limits the effectiveness of UEBA deployments. Another significant challenge is data overload and the ability to effectively analyze the massive volumes of data generated by UEBA systems. Extracting meaningful insights from this data requires advanced analytics capabilities and robust data management infrastructure. Finally, false positives remain a significant concern, as UEBA systems can generate alerts that are not indicative of actual threats, leading to alert fatigue and potentially overlooking genuine security incidents. Addressing these challenges requires a combination of technological advancements, skilled professionals, and improved user training to maximize the effectiveness of UEBA solutions.
